Transaction 699b23ce72f05e06d8432ebc608c154339a9c7aa7e6e7e323916169d2768b0bb
1 Input
1 Output
-
699b23ce72f05e06d8432ebc608c154339a9c7aa7e6e7e323916169d2768b0bb:0
- value
- 174996579
- script pubkey
- OP_0 OP_PUSHBYTES_20 24b5ade3de2f4723bf14a42552f192180e19e400
- address
- bc1qyj66mc779arj80c55sj49uvjrq8pneqq3l2fus